I cleaned up the rims with this really cool brillo-like/type flapper wheel (p/n info in pic). The flaps have grit on one the sides of them. I was surprised at the results it has. Should be neat to use for other projects.
What really worked well and fast was putting the rim on a swivel shop chair and adjusted the height of the rims with blocks to meet that sanding wheel. I even added a block to the back of the grinding motor to get the angled surfaces.
The rims originally had polished center. But I wanted a cast look so I bought some Rustoleum textured Dark Pewter spray paint
Note block to tilt grinder and block under rim to get the rim up to the abrasive wheel.
